Articles of centos7

在VPS上升级磁盘大小之后如何扩展CentOS 7 /分区

我们有一个CentOS 7的VPS和20GB的SSD空间,后来我们把它升级到了160GB,但是我对如何扩展/分区有点困惑。 我们有多个完整的备份,但我宁愿不重新安装一切只是为了扩大磁盘的大小。 df -h给出以下结果: Filesystem Size Used Avail Use% Mounted on /dev/mapper/vg-lv_root 18G 12G 5.3G 68% / devtmpfs 3.9G 0 3.9G 0% /dev tmpfs 3.9G 0 3.9G 0% /dev/shm tmpfs 3.9G 8.5M 3.9G 1% /run tmpfs 3.9G 0 3.9G 0% /sys/fs/cgroup /dev/sda1 477M 193M 255M 44% /boot tmpfs 799M 0 799M 0% /run/user/0 fdisk […]

SSSD站点与Active Directory

我是pipe理我们的AD基础架构的Windowspipe理员。 我们的Linux团队已经build立了一些CentOS 7虚拟机,并将它们configuration为使用SSSD来join域。 最初的configuration是在一个不同的站点(不是以前写的域)查询一个DC,所以我让他们使用带有SSSD的AD站点进行研究。 服务器现在返回来自DNS的3个_ldap DClogging。 第一个尝试是从一个不同的网站,所以它不能访问它。 第二个作品,它检索正确的网站名称。 一段时间(不知道究竟有多长时间),它会使用响应的DC,在这段时间过去之后,它将开始从DNS获取3个_ldaplogging。 这导致了我们被要求解决的login延迟。 如果我们在configuration中设置了站点名称,那么它一直都在运行,但是我们必须考虑将这些虚拟机从备份中还原到其他设置了站点名称的站点上。 我不知道CentOS中的很多configuration,但有没有一种方法可以正常工作,或者它已经在做什么?

httpd没有启动,因为/ run / httpd丢失

httpd无法启动运行centos 7的服务器之一,因为/ run / httpd丢失,这意味着httpd无法创build/run/httpd/httpd.pid,从而无法启动。 我的问题是,为什么/ run / httpd被删除。 我不删除目录。 从基本CentOS仓库运行httpd-2.4.6-18.el7.centos.x86_64

通过yum安装MariaDB + Galera失败,并且没有“可用的包MariaDB-Galera-server”

我创build了一个全新的Cento OS 7虚拟机,我正在学习本教程来安装MariaDB + Galera集群。 我已经添加了MariaDB回购,如下所示: vi /etc/yum.repos.d/MariaDB.repo 然后填充它 [mariadb] name = MariaDB baseurl = http://yum.mariadb.org/10.0/centos7-amd64 g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B gpgcheck=1 现在,我应该运行sudo yum install MariaDB-Galera-server MariaDB-client galera进行安装, 之前已经为我工作 ,但是由于某种原因,这次只安装了MariaDB-client和galera,我得到yum这个令人惊讶的消息: No package MariaDB-Galera-server available. 任何想法为什么? 编辑: 比较Fedora , CentOS和RedHat仓库,看起来只有Fedora仓库有这个软件包。 这是一个部署错误?

如何将以太网设备设置为Centos 7上的特定硬件

我有一个Centos 7系统,我已经禁用了新的networking命名系统,并恢复到旧的系统(eth0,eth1等)。 我这样做是因为我在RDO Openstack设置中使用了这个,并且这需要在几个不同的主机上使用相同的以太网设备名称。 其中一些主机在kvm下是virt,并使用eth命名系统。 由于这样做,每一次重启,我的以太网设备翻转。 我明白,在一个健康的起动 [11.172339] tg3 0000:03:00.0 eth0:Tigon3 [partno(BCM95723)rev 5784100](PCI Express)MAC地址68:b5:99:72:d8:02 [11.269599] e1000e 0000:02:00.0 eth1 🙁 PCI Express:2.5GT / s:宽度x1)68:05:ca:04:90:16 在“坏引导”中,这些将被翻转,e1000e将为eth0,tg3为eth1。 到目前为止,我已经做了以下工作: 在/ etc / default / grub中的GRUB_CMDLINE_LINUX行中添加了“net.ifnames = 0 biosdevname = 0” grub2-mkconfig -o /boot/grub2/grub.cfg 创build/etc/udev/rules.d/70-persistent-net.rules 运行grub2-mkconfig之后,我在/boot/grub2/grub.cfg中看到以下内容(这意味着我上面的更改正在生效) linux16 /boot/vmlinuz-3.10.0-123.el7.x86_64 root = UUID = eabee081-85f8-4f33-b72a-fbbdc575e010 ro vconsole.keymap = uk crashkernel = auto […]

CentOS kickstart突袭1和LVM问题

使用kickstart进行CentOS 7的无人值守安装。 我设置了两个磁盘给我镜像。 bootloader –location=mbr –driveorder=sda,sdb zerombr clearpart –all –initlabel # Disk partitioning part raid.01 –fstype="raid" –ondisk=sda –size=500 part raid.02 –fstype="raid" –grow –ondisk=sda –size=1 part raid.03 –fstype="raid" –ondisk=sdb –size=500 part raid.04 –fstype="raid" –grow –ondisk=sdb –size=1 raid /boot –device=md0 –fstype="ext4" –level=1 raid.01 raid.03 raid pv.01 –device=md1 –level=1 raid.02 raid.04 volgroup VolGroup pv.01 logvol swap –vgname="VolGroup" –size=4096 […]

CentOS 7 / proc / net / ip_conntrack:没有这样的文件或目录

昨天我必须硬重置我的服务器,并从重置我可以看到在munin-node.log的以下问题: 2015/04/28-04:10:02 CONNECT TCP Peer: "[::ffff:127.0.0.1]:58663" Local: "[::ffff:127.0.0.1]:4949" 2015/04/28-04:10:03 [10824] Error output from fw_conntrack: 2015/04/28-04:10:03 [10824] cat: /proc/net/ip_conntrack: No such file or directory 2015/04/28-04:10:04 [10824] Error output from fw_forwarded_local: 2015/04/28-04:10:04 [10824] Can't find conntrack information 并且不会Connections through firewallgraphics和ipconntrackgraphics生成Connections through firewall 。 在服务器重置munin正确工作之前(我可以包括graphics图像)。 你有一些提示,链接或类似的东西来解决这个问题,请? 我很抱歉,但我的服务器configuration知识不是很好。

systemctl无法parsingkill模式,忽略混合

在CentOS 7上,我想检查nginx服务的状态: # systemctl status nginx -l nginx.service – The nginx HTTP and reverse proxy server Loaded: loaded (/usr/lib/systemd/system/nginx.service; disabled) Active: inactive (dead) Jun 30 03:40:08 dev01 systemd[1]: [/usr/lib/systemd/system/nginx.service:13] Failed to parse kill mode, ignoring mixed 那么我启用它: # systemctl enable nginx并再次检查它: # systemctl status nginx -l nginx.service – The nginx HTTP and reverse proxy server […]

MariaDB崩溃,现在不会启动

当激活一个wordpress插件MariaDB在我身上坠毁,它不会重新启动。 我正在使用Centos 7.1。 systemctl状态: systemctl status mariadb.service mariadb.service – MariaDB database server Loaded: loaded (/usr/lib/systemd/system/mariadb.service; enabled) Active: failed (Result: exit-code) since Tue 2015-10-27 20:22:02 EDT; 2min 29s ago Process: 3587 ExecStartPost=/usr/libexec/mariadb-wait-ready $MAINPID (code=exited, status=1/FAILURE) Process: 3586 ExecStart=/usr/bin/mysqld_safe –basedir=/usr (code=exited, status=0/SUCCESS) Process: 3559 ExecStartPre=/usr/libexec/mariadb-prepare-db-dir %n (code=exited, status=0/SUCCESS) Main PID: 3586 (code=exited, status=0/SUCCESS) Oct 27 20:22:01 s1.pavelow.net […]

CentOS7:KVM:错误:无法创build用户运行时目录'/ run / user / 0 / libvirt':权限被拒绝

试图解决我通过让我们的Nagios安装使用KVM插件check_kvmfind的问题。 我认为我的问题归结为与nagios / nrpe用户的权限问题。 安装nrpe和插件后,我没有任何其他标准插件如check_disk或check_load等问题。基本上,kvm插件使用virsh来检查状态,所以我启用loginnrpe(也尝试过nagios用户,但它出现服务在nrpe用户下运行)并尝试以下操作: [root@vhost3 ~]# su nrpe sh-4.2$ virsh list –all error: failed to connect to the hypervisor error: no valid connection error: Cannot create user runtime directory '/run/user/0/libvirt': Permission denied 但是当然这个命令没有问题,当然在本地尝试的时候插件会执行得很好: [root@vhost3 ~]# virsh list –all Id Name State —————————————————- 2 www running [root@vhost3 ~]# /usr/lib64/nagios/plugins/check_kvm hosts:1 OK:1 WARN:0 CRIT:0 – www:running […]